
Canal calcique
Les canaux calciques sont des protéines membranaires qui régulent le flux d'ions calcium dans et hors des cellules, ce qui est essentiel pour diverses fonctions cellulaires, y compris la contraction musculaire, la libération de neurotransmetteurs et l'expression génique. La dysrégulation de l'activité des canaux calciques est associée à des conditions telles que l'hypertension, les arythmies cardiaques et les troubles neurologiques.
